Stuart B. Cherney, M.D.

Dr. Stuart Cherney received his medical degree in 1977 from the Albany Medical College, and subsequently completed a residency in orthopaedics at Mt. Sinai Hospital in New York City.  His post-doctoral training included a Fellowship at the prestigious Cincinnati Sports Medicine and Orthopaedic Center in Knee & Sports Medicine.  Practicing since 1983, Dr. Cherney is board-certified in orthopaedic surgery and specializes in Sports Medicine. 

Some of the honors received include:

  • Best Doctors in New York Metropolitan Area
  • Stony Brook University Statesman and VIP Award,
  • Stony Brook University Gridiron Award.

Currently, Dr. Cherney is the Chief of Orthopaedics at the North Shore Surgi-Center Inc. in Smithtown, NY.  He also is on staff at St. Catherine of Siena Medical Center and serves as a Clinical Assistant Professor of Orthopaedics at the Stony Brook University School of Medicine.  As Adjunct Assistant Professor in the School of Health, Technology and Management he is the medical director of the Athletic Training and Education Program at Stony Brook University. 

Dr. Cherney is  the Head Team Physician for all Varsity Teams at Stony Brook University and Orthopedic consultant to St. Joseph's and Suffolk Community Colleges.  He has been  a Staff Physician for the New York Empire State Games for the past 20 years.

Dr. Cherney maintains a number of professional affiliations.  He is an active member of:

  • Diplomate, American Board of Orthopaedic Surgery
  • Fellow, American Academy of Orthopaedic Surgeons
  • Arthroscopy Association of North America
  • American Orthopaedic Society for Sports Medicine
  • NYS Society of Orthopaedic Surgeons
  • American College of Sports Medicine

Robin J. Kammerer, R.P.A.-C

Kammerer is a Physician Assistant who has been affiliated with All-Sport Orthopaedics for eight years.  Robin attended Hofstra University where she majored in Exercise Physiology and minored in Athletic Training and Psychology.  During her time at Division I Hofstra University, she played Field Hocky and Lacrosse. 

After graduation, she pursued a career as a Physician Assistant.  She attended the Weill Medical College of Cornell University where her clinical rotations focused on orthopaedic surgery.  Robin is a certified Physician Assistant through the National Commission of Physician Assistants and has earned special recognition for achievements in and knowledge of surgery and is licensed to practice in the State of New York.
